Step 1
~1 min

Brew 1 fluid ounce of espresso.

Step 2
~1 min

Add 1 fluid ounce of brewed espresso, 1 1/2 fluid ounces of vodka, 1 1/2 fluid ounces of coffee-flavored liqueur, 1 fluid ounce of white creme de cacao, and 1 cup of ice to a cocktail shaker.

Step 3
~1 min

Cover the shaker tightly.

Step 4
~1 min

Shake vigorously until the shaker feels very cold and the outside is frosted.

Step 5
~1 min

Strain the mixture into a chilled martini glass.

Step 6
~1 min

Serve immediately.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Use high-quality espresso for the best flavor.

Chill the martini glass ahead of time for a colder drink.

Garnish with a few coffee beans.
